When designing hotels and spa complexes, it is essential not only to create an attractive interior but also to shape the emotions guests experience. Every space should encourage visitors to slow down, relax, and recharge. That is why every architectural element—from lighting to the ceiling—plays a role in supporting the overall concept.

In this project, the KRAFT team delivered a ceiling solution for a mountain spa hotel where the main idea was to combine natural materials, carefully designed lighting, and clean architectural geometry. The centerpiece of the interior is the Suspended ceiling with cube-shaped rail, which integrates seamlessly into the architectural concept while emphasizing the character of the space.

The Ceiling as an Architectural Element

In hospitality interiors, the ceiling has evolved far beyond its functional purpose. It defines the rhythm of a space, enhances its proportions, and brings together every design element into one harmonious composition.

In this spa hotel, the cube-shaped rail creates a distinctive linear pattern that visually extends the space, highlights its scale, and adds depth to the interior. Thanks to its open structure, the ceiling feels light and airy without overwhelming even large relaxation areas.

Lighting That Works Together with the Ceiling

Lighting plays a crucial role in shaping the atmosphere of this project. Linear light fixtures positioned between the rails create soft shadows while emphasizing the depth and texture of the ceiling.

As a result, lighting becomes more than a functional necessity—it becomes an integral part of the architectural composition. During the evening hours, the interior gains an even warmer and more relaxing atmosphere, which is especially important for spa and wellness areas.

Practical Performance Without Compromise

The Suspended ceiling with cube-shaped rail combines visual appeal with outstanding functionality. Its design allows ventilation, lighting systems, and other engineering services to be seamlessly integrated while maintaining a clean and refined appearance.

At the same time, maintenance access to technical systems remains simple and convenient—an important advantage for hotels where engineering systems operate continuously.

The durability of metal also ensures long service life with minimal maintenance while preserving the ceiling’s appearance even under intensive daily use.
